What's eating my blackberry 'triple crown'?

Spotted wing drosophila (Drosophila suzukii)

Signs: Female uses a serrated ovipositor to puncture intact, firm-skinned ripening blackberries; larvae cause the berry to rapidly collapse and turn mushy; infestation rates in blackberry are among the highest of any fruit crop

Control: Fine exclusion netting (under 1 mm mesh) is the most effective barrier; apply spinosad or pyrethrin sprays at first colour change; harvest frequently and remove all overripe fruit; use adult monitoring traps from midsummer

Japanese beetle (Popillia japonica — US)

Signs: Adults skeletonize leaves, leaving a lacy brown skeleton; large groups feed on ripe fruit simultaneously, causing rapid crop loss

Control: Hand-pick adults in early morning into soapy water; use row cover fabric during peak beetle flight (early to midsummer); neem oil or pyrethrin sprays; avoid Japanese beetle pheromone traps near the planting as they attract more beetles than they catch

Aphids (Macrosiphum euphorbiae and allies)

Signs: Colonies on growing tips cause shoot distortion and honeydew; can transmit blackberry calico virus causing pale leaf mottling

Control: Apply insecticidal soap or neem oil to affected tips; attract ladybirds and lacewings; ant control helps as ants protect aphid colonies from predators

Rednecked cane borer (Agrilus ruficollis)

Signs: Larvae tunnel in a spiral under the bark of first-year canes, forming a distinctive cigar-shaped gall; galled canes snap or die back from the top

Control: Prune out and destroy affected canes at the first sign of wilting or galling; cut 15 cm below the gall; dispose of canes away from the planting; no effective chemical control once larvae are inside the cane
